The MVP introduces enhanced mobile technology to reduce child and maternal mortality

Children and mothers across the Millennium Villages (MV) will benefit from a new health application based on mobile phone technology that will be used at the household level in all sites. The technology was presented to community health teams at a continent-wide workshop held in Nairobi in February 2010. Launch of a New Base Station for Mobile Communications in Pampaida

On Thursday, May 21, 2009, the Pampaida Millennium Village celebrated the launch of a new base station that will provide mobile communications to this rural Nigerian community. The installation was made possible by a partnership with Ericsson, a leading telecom supplier, and Zain, a leading mobile operator in the Middle East and Africa.
